"Stayed for 6 days at this brand new resort. Nicely decorated and very clean room overlooking the Aegean; air conditioning worked great; housekeeping was spot on, thorough and asked numerous times/days if I needed anything; ate primarily at the restaurant in the lobby which was very good - in fact some of the best Turkish food I had in Kusadasi, bar none. The staff were friendly and eager to please but, sometimes, their lack of experience showed in small things (e.g., charging drinks/meals to your room even when you want to pay at the table). Nothing, I am sure, the staff and management will not fix with time. Hotel is walking distance to the town - about a 35-40 minute walk downhill. Coming back, which is uphill, is better left to a taxi. Overall, a very pleasant, quiet and relaxing experience. I would definitely come back. "

"It was a great time in a great hotel! We arrived late at midnight at the hotel, and the lobby was very lively, which made us very welcome! We also got the option to have a late dinner, simple but very tasty food in the main restaurant, after our long trip. The staff are amazing, attentive, and courteous. You see people working everywhere all the time (they are very hardworking people, and they do deserve tips always, if you can). The cleanliness isn't 5 stars, and I'm blaming the buildings around the hotel, which are many at this time. So the balcony is always dusty, but you can request to clean it from the app or with housekeeping.
The bed wasn't the best one I have had, but it is ok, are couple beds, not 2 single beds together.
The towels were changed every day during our stay
The main restaurant there has a lot of options of food options from European to Azian. Nice and very tasty!
We went to 2 A La Cart restaurants (Mexican and Italian), and even the staff were nice, the food wasn't the best I have tried. So, go to the free options if you have, but don't pay for Italian, even if it is only €10 per person.
There are kids' dance and show activities every night. I found it a bit late to start at 20h45, going to 22h, but it should be fine for most.
The beach doesn't worsen the trip. I'm a beach person and have been in many beautiful ones. The view is nice and beautiful. The water is clear until kids start playing in the sand on the edge. I think isn't natural sand.

The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 80°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 51°F. Average annual precipitation for Yavansu is 34 inches.
